VASAS (VASculitis Association Switzerland) connects people suffering from vasculitis (inflammation of the blood vessel walls*), their relatives and caregivers, as well as individuals with a professional and/or personal interest in the disease.
Foundation of VASAS
On September 10, 2021, VASAS was founded as a non-profit association in Bern.
We are a Swiss interest group of patients, doctors, scientists and specialists who deal with vasculitis.
VASAS pursues interdisciplinary and interprofessional cooperation as well as a comprehensive exchange with other domestic and foreign vasculitis organizations.
VASAS strives to fulfill the following goals in particular:
Understanding the clinical picture
Promoting understanding of conditions such as Takayasu arteritis (TAK), giant cell arteritis (GCA), ANCA-associated vasculitis (AAV) and Behçet's syndrome (BS) by providing information (literature, research findings, training courses)
Promotion of knowledge
Promoting knowledge about the causes, progression and medical, psychological and social consequences of vasculitis through clinically oriented research and further training for those affected and specialists.
Raising awareness among professionals
Raising awareness among specialists for the early detection and diagnosis of vasculitis and ensuring the best possible treatment and care for patients
Networking of affected persons
Networking among those affected to exchange experiences and promote social cohesion and integration
Advice from experts
Advice, support and guidance for those affected and professionals, as well as promoting the optimal integration of patients into their social environment and helping them to achieve the highest possible quality of life.
Cross-organisational networking
Networking with other organisations and associations in Germany and abroad that deal with vasculitis
